Waco Family Medicine Primary Care Internship
The Waco Family Medicine (WFM) Primary Care Internship is a paid summer internship lasting approximately 6 weeks from June 15 – July 24, 2026. The goal of the program is to provide undergraduate students in biomedical and health sciences access to clinical shadowing and opportunities to contribute meaningfully to primary care research projects under the mentorship of experienced medical professionals and principal investigators. Candidates who would benefit from additional clinical observational experience are prioritized.
Interest in a career in primary care (particularly Family Medicine) is preferred. Interns are expected to work 30-40 hours a week and will receive a stipend at the conclusion of the internship.
Eligibility:
- Currently enrolled at Baylor University
- Currently classified as a Sophomore or Junior (an upcoming Junior or Senior for the 2026/2027 academic year)
- Current Medical Humanities major, minor, or concentration
Applications have now closed as of January 30, 2026. Interns will be announced March 6, 2026.
After an initial review, some candidates will be invited to interview with the Waco Family Medicine Internship coordinator for final selection.
